Job summary

This post is a jointCommunications and Administration role (0.6 WTE)with a fractionalPublic and Patient Involvement and Engagement (PPIE)component(0.4 WTE).

If appointed, you will support the smooth delivery of communications, engagement, and administrative tasks across a range of projects within the Secure Data Environment programme. You will help organise and deliver public engagement activities, support communications outputs, and ensure effective coordination of meetings, recruitment processes, and content creation.

This is a delivery and operations-focused role. Strategic design and creative engagement approaches will beretainedby the Communications and Engagement Director. The postholder will play a vital role in ensuring day-to-day delivery, problem-solving, and operational follow-through.

Main duties of the job

Communications and Administrative Support (0.6 WTE)

  • Managelogisticsand administration for meetings, events, and workshops.

  • Provide minutes, record actions, and ensuretimelyfollow-up.

  • Support procurement processes (e.g., hiring professional services for creative resource development).

  • Maintain and update communication channels, including social media accounts.

  • Assistwith the preparation of newsletters, reports, and public-facing content.

  • Collate and organise feedback from events and activities.

  • Support the development of routine comms outputs for programmes (e.g., research asset registers, DAC updates, infrastructure communications).

Public Engagement Support (0.4 WTE)

  • Support the organisation of public and community group meetings (online and in-person).

  • Help recruit new members of public groups, including advertising, sorting applications, and supporting induction processes.Coordinatelogistics(dates, times, locations, agendas, materials) for engagement activities.

  • Act as the first point of contact for public members' queries.

  • Ensure activities are inclusive and welcoming to all participants.

  • Collect and summarise qualitative and quantitative insights from engagement work.

Disclosure and Barring Service Check

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.

Certificate of Sponsorship

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website (Opens in a new tab).

From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).
